A 15-year-old died in a shooting at an apartment complex in Renton Sunday evening. A second 15-year-old was injured in the shooting, and was taken to a local hospital.
The shooting, which took place at an apartment building near Bronson Way N.E. and Vuemont Place N.E., allegedly involved two parties in two different vehicles, according to the Renton Police Department (RPD).
Someone in the suspect vehicle opened fire and shot two 15-year-olds in another car. The vehicle with the two teens inside took off and tried to get to a nearby hospital, eventually pulling off at the Les Schwab Tire shop on Rainier Avenue S. to call for help. One of the 15-year-olds died at the Les Schwab parking lot.
The other injured 15-year-old was taken to Harborview Medical Center, and is in stable condition, as of this reporting.
RPD has yet to share any details on the suspect vehicle. Detectives are currently attempting to view any security camera footage from any neighboring business that could lead to identifying a suspect.
